Abstract
An improved apparatus for injecting fluid into an internal combustion engine includes a fluid conduit in the engine's cylinder head for discharging fluid into the zone of the valve head. The fluid conduit outlet is positioned so that when the valve is in the seated or closed position, the outlet is substantially closed, and when the valve is in the open, unseated position, the outlet is open, thereby permitting a substantial flow of fluid through the conduit only when the valve is open.
